What is a program manager contract?

A Program Manager Contract job is a temporary or fixed-term role where a professional oversees multiple related projects, ensuring alignment with business goals. These managers coordinate teams, manage budgets, mitigate risks, and drive project execution within a specified timeframe. Unlike full-time roles, contract positions typically focus on delivering specific outcomes within a limited duration. Program Manager Contractors may work for a company directly or through a consulting firm. Their expertise is critical in implementing strategic initiatives ef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a program manager contract?

To thrive as a Program Manager Contract, you need strong project management abilities, expertise in contract negotiation, and a relevant degree or equivalent experience in business or a related field. Familiarity with project management software (such as MS Project or Asana), contract management systems, and certifications like PMP or Contract Management Certification are often preferred.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and stakeholder management skills are essential so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ure smooth program delivery, compliance with contractual obligations, and effective collaboration with cross-functional teams.

What are the typical challenges faced by program manager contracts and how can they be overcome?

Program Manager Contracts often face the challenge of balancing multiple projects while ensuring all contractual obligations are met on time and within budget. Navigating complex stakeholder requirements and adapting to changing project scopes are also common hurdles. Successful Program Managers overcome these by maintaining clear communication, prioritizing tasks effectively, and leveraging project management tools to track progress. Building strong relationships with clients, vendors, and internal teams is crucial to navigate and resolve challenges as they arise. Being proactive and detail-oriented can greatly contribute to success in this dynamic role.

Job Overview and Responsibilities

The Manager-Technical Contract Performance is responsible for driving improved supplier performance by enforcing liquidated damage remedies for late delivery of aircraft parts and managing contract intelligence initiatives. Manager will supervise up to four international direct reports, tasked with identifying, initiating and settling lead time and turnaround time claims, along with tracking, capturing and processing payment of such claims from United's aircraft goods and services suppliers. This position acts as the primary liaison to the Strategic Sourcing department in the development of contract language in support of obtaining such remedies and serves as a subject matter expert in the area of technical contract product support provisions, contract incentives, and the integration of contract intelligence solutions into contract management processes.

  • Perform and supervise analysis of annual volume of over 120,000 purchase orders and 150,000 repair orders
  • Identify available remedies from overdue orders
  • Initiate and settle over 600 claims per year
  • Manage contract intelligence initiatives supporting contract management processes, including coordination of requirements, implementation activities, and integration of solutions designed to improve contract analysis and accessibility across Tech Ops Supply Chain
  • Maintain proficiency and currency with Warranty Administration team by supporting a portfolio of claims with vendors
  • Collaborate and liaise with the Strategic Sourcing team in the drafting of liquidated damages language in new agreements
  • Support recurrent training of product support provisions contained in all technical contracts
